3, Functional requirement

Is concerned with actual performance of the system that is going to be developed. Also it does
describe the functionality or service provided by the new system. It also describes the
interactions between the system and the user.

 Customer, Account, and Location Management

This includes the creation, maintenance, and use of customer accounts.  

 . Rates and Fees Management

This includes the maintenance and application of all utility rates, miscellaneous charges, fees,
and taxes.  

 Meter Reading and Inventory Management

This includes meter inventory, reading, and consumption requirements.  

 Billing Management

This includes the preparation, calculation, printing, and mailing of bills.  

 Financial Management

This includes payments, adjustments, refunds, deposits, and accounting entries.  

 Delinquency Management

This includes penalties and interest, payment plans, shut offs, and collections.  

 . Service Order Management

This includes creating, completing, and managing service orders.  

 Reporting

3
This includes standard and user created reports to query data.

3.3, Functional requirements


Functional requirement describes the interaction between the system and its environment

 Add customer: The system registers applicant’s First name, Last name, Kebele, Woreda,
House number, Telephone number and then save to the database.
 Add Employee: The system registers employee’s First name, Last name, position,
telephone number and then saves to the database.
 Customer Maintenance orders: customers get services online by filling his/her ID and
description about the service to be ordered.
 Display customer’s payment information: The system displays customers’ bill detail
when they enter their ID number.
 Display news about the organization: The system can provide different information to
customers and post notices like vacancy announcement.
 Receive maintenance order: The system receives complaintfrom customers.
 Receive meter reader information: The system receives monthly customers’ water
consumption and calculate the bill.
 setting privilege for employee: the system give different privilege for each actors

 Generate Report: the system generates different reports. Like payment report,
maintenance report.
